导读:
在进行数据查询时,我们经常需要知道数据总共有多少页 。这个问题对于分页显示数据非常重要 。MySQL可以通过简单的计算来快速得出总页数 。本文将介绍如何使用MySQL计算总页数 。
1. 计算总记录数
首先,我们需要计算总记录数 。可以使用COUNT函数来实现 。例如,我们要计算一个表中所有记录的数量,可以使用以下语句:
SELECT COUNT(*) FROM table_name;
【mysql求总 mysql总页数计算】2. 计算总页数
一旦我们得到了总记录数 , 就可以计算总页数了 。假设每页显示10条记录,可以使用以下公式来计算总页数:
总页数 = 总记录数 / 每页显示的记录数
如果总记录数不能被每页显示的记录数整除,那么总页数应该加1 。可以使用CEIL函数来实现向上取整 。例如,如果总记录数为25,每页显示10条记录,那么总页数应该是3 。
SELECT CEIL(COUNT(*)/10) as total_pages FROM table_name;
总结:
通过以上步骤,我们可以快速地计算出MySQL中数据的总页数 。这对于分页显示数据非常有用 。我们可以使用COUNT函数来计算总记录数,然后使用CEIL函数来计算总页数 。希望本文能够帮助您更好地理解MySQL的使用方法 。
推荐阅读
- mysql分布式事务解决方案 mysql分布式方案双活
- sql修复语句 ibdmysql修复
- mysql重启后无法启动 重启mysql服务出错
- mysql8.0索引 mysql索引数目
- mysql跳过密码验证修改密码 mysql跳过授权登录
- mysql配置系统变量吗
- iphone12pro的屏占比 mdl和mysql的区别
- mysql的随机函数 mysql随机优化
- 如何查看云服务器的下行带宽? 云服务器的下行带宽怎么看